Warning: To avoid the risk of personal injury or property damage from fire or electrical shock, only
use the Uniden battery model and Uniden adapter model specifically designated for this product.
Caution:
Use only the specified Uniden battery pack (BT-905).
Do not remove the batteries from the handset to charge it.
Never throw the battery into a fire, disassemble, or heat it.
Do not remove or damage the battery casing.
Installing the Rechargeable Battery for Cordless Handset
1) Press down on the cordless handset battery case
cover (use the finger indention for a better grip) and
slide the cover downward to remove.
2) Plug the battery pack connector (red & black wires)
into the jack inside the battery compartment. (The
connector notches fit into the grooves of the jack only
one way.) Match the wire colors to the polarity label
in the battery compartment, connect the battery and
listen for a click to insure connection.
3) Make sure you have a good connection by slightly
pulling on the battery wires. If the connection is
secure, the battery jack will remain in place.
4) Place the battery case cover back on the handset
and slide it upwards until it clicks into place.
Note: Use only the Uniden BT-905 rechargeable battery pack supplied with your cordless telephone.
